  • 2G3S Nature Walk at Dernford Reservoir, Stapleford/Sawston

    Dernford Reservoir Stapleford

        Our first 2021 local nature walk will be around Dernford Reservoir on Saturday 26th June between 2-3 pm.  The reservoir area was opened for public access following amelioration of the former gravel quarry.  There is a meadow flora around the reservoir and some interesting bird life including Goosander, Great-crested Grebe, Tufted Duck and Common Terns
